(1) An appeal shall lie to the Collector against any order of the Mamlatdar. (2) Save as otherwise provided in this Act, the provisions of Chapter XIII of the Code shall apply to appeals to the Collector under this Act as if the Collector were the immediate superior of the Mamlatdar.
